自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

转载 JavaScript高级应用——类与函数篇

TypeNote:JavaScript为弱类型的语言 Note:定义变量a的方法为: “var a;”且可以在定义的同时指定值,编译器将根据给定的值来判断类型。 Javascript is a dynamically and weakly typed language. Variables are declared with the keyword var, and the type

2007-03-16 17:16:00 1921

转载 由浅到深了解JavaScript类

类是什么?    许多刚接触编程的朋友都可能理解不了类,其实类是对我们这个现实世界的模拟,把它说成“类别”或者“类型”可能会更容易理解一些。比如“人”这种动物就是一个类,而具体某一个人就是“人”这个类的一个实例,“人”可以有许多实例(地球人超过六十亿了),但“人”这个类只有一个。你或许会说那男人和女人不也是人么?怎么只能有一个?其实这里要谈到一个继承的东西,后边才讲,请继续看下去。如何建立一个类?

2007-03-16 17:14:00 669

转载 对几个 javascript framework 的评价

近日刚好在无忧里看到一篇讨论脚本框架的帖子,我想谈谈我对目前几个脚本框架的看法(Silverna、Dron Framework、Zerg、script_aculo_us、prototype、bindows、JSVM),(不过我得说一下前提,这里是在讨论框架而非单个功能):TNND,我这么一写,把国内外写框架的人都得罪光了。Silverna:1、使用 标签太多,使用者不可能知道要实现某个功能而

2007-03-16 17:12:00 649

转载 prototype源码分析

现在就从一个javascript的开发框架prototype_1.3.1(下面简称为prototype)开始。我本来是想先介绍一下javascript的高级应用,但怕水平不够,说的没有条理,所以就结合prototype来说,顺便会提及js的语法使用。下面是框架最前面的两段代码:var Prototype = {  Version: 1.3.1,  emptyFunction: function

2007-03-15 17:07:00 652

转载 Prototype入门学习

什么是PrototypePrototype 是由 Sam Stephenson 开发的一个 Javascript 类库,也是其他框架的鼻祖。其对现有的部分 Javascript 对象比如 Object 、 Function 、 Dom 、 String 等进行扩展,并且对 Ajax 应用进行封装,借此提供了兼容标准的更加易于使用的类库,极大的方便开发人员快速创建具备高度交互性的 Web2.0

2007-03-15 16:52:00 556

转载 prototype.js 1.4版开发者手册(强烈推荐)

prototype.js开发者手册 对应版本1.4.0 original article by sp(Sergio Pereira) Sergio Pereiralast update: March 30th 2006中文版:THIN最后更新:2006-3-31其它版本English versionPDF (v1.4.0)Kore

2007-03-15 16:50:00 671

转载 【Prototype 1.4.0】源码解读----全文注释版

/*  Prototype JavaScript framework, version 1.4.0 *  (c) 2005 Sam Stephenson  * *  Prototype is freely distributable under the terms of an MIT-style license. *  For details, see the Prototype web site

2007-03-14 14:57:00 681

转载 JavaScript中this关键字使用方法详解

在面向对象编程语言中,对于this关键字我们是非常熟悉的。比如C++、C#和Java等都提供了这个关键字,虽然在开始学习的时候觉得比较难,但只要理解了,用起来是非常方便和意义确定的。JavaScript也提供了这个this关键字,不过用起来就比经典OO语言中要"混乱"的多了。    下面就来看看,在JavaScript中各种this的使用方法有什么混乱之处?    1、在HTML元素事件属性中in

2007-03-09 18:22:00 779

转载 关于Javascript 的 prototype问题

prototype1、prototype是与Clone联系起来的,也就是说,当创建实例时,prototype会把成员clone到该Class(function)的实例上。Detail: 最常见的几个内置内对象里的prototype,如:Array原型有join, split方法,当创建数组a时var a=[1,2],原型里的所有方法都被clone到a上。2、this是该类的实例指针(该指针为"动态

2007-03-09 15:58:00 3014

转载 把应用程序从 Internet Explorer 迁移到 Mozilla

Doron Rosenberg (doronr@us.ibm.com), 助理软件工程师, IBM2006 年 12 月 28 日使 特定于 Internet Explorer 的 Web 应用程序在 Mozilla 上运行时,您遇到过麻烦吗?本文讨论了将应用程序迁移到基于开源 Mozilla 浏览器上时的常见问题。首先讨论跨浏览器开发的基本技术,然后介绍克服 Mozilla 和 Inte

2007-03-09 14:51:00 684

转载 在IE 和 Firefox 中兼容使用js

在家在写页面的时候,尤其是一些门户网站,最后项目组有人规范以下javascript的写法,尽量做到一处编写,多处运行;  这里有4条经验: 1、在定义 页面元素的时候,如果该页面元素不需要被脚本调用,那么它就不需要定义其name和id属性; 2、如果需要定义页面元素的name,id属性,那么避免不同元素的name和id相同;3、如果没有特殊需要,尽量让name和id相同,这主要是为

2007-03-09 14:34:00 686

原创 Javascript的IE和Firefox兼容性汇编

以下以 IE 代替 Internet Explorer,以 MF 代替 Mozzila Firefox1. document.form.item 问题(1)现有问题:现有代码中存在许多 document.formName.item("itemName") 这样的语句,不能在 MF 下运行(2)解决方法:改用 document.formName.elements["elementName"](3)其

2007-03-09 12:08:00 863

转载 2007 年 XML 的十大预测

    Elliotte Rusty Harold 预测 XML 在新一年中的发展情况    Elliotte Rusty Harold (elharo@metalab.unc.edu), 副教授, Polytechnic University    2007 年 3 月 06 日    对于 XML 来说,2006 年是静悄悄的一年。2007 年是否会更令人激动呢?是的,Elliotte R

2007-03-07 11:49:00 636

转载 XML 问题: 超越DOM(轻松使用 DOM 的技巧和诀窍)

Dethe Elza (delza@livingcode.org), 高级技术架构师, Blast Radius     文档对象模型(Document Object Model,DOM)是用于操纵 XML 和 HTML 数据的最常用工具之一,然而它的潜力却很少被充分挖掘出来。通过利用 DOM 的优势,并使它更加易用,您将获得一款应用于 XML 应用程序(包括动态 Web 应用程序)的强大工具

2007-03-06 18:17:00 739

原创 document 文挡对象详解(JavaScript脚本语言描述)

[注:页面上元素name属性和JavaScript引用的名称必须一致包括大小写,否则会提示你一个错误信息 "引用的元素为空或者不是对象"]========================================================================对象属性:document.title             //设置文档标题等价于HTML的标签documen

2007-03-06 16:08:00 741

转载 一篇关于session的好文章,写的很详细

目录:一、术语session二、HTTP协议与状态保持三、理解cookie机制四、理解session机制五、理解javax.servlet.http.HttpSession六、HttpSession常见问题七、跨应用程序的session共享八、总结参考文档一、术语session在我的经验里,session这个词被滥用的程度大概仅次于transaction,更加有趣的是transaction与ses

2007-03-06 16:02:00 588

转载 如何优化JavaScript脚本的性能

[转]作者:[url=http://wiki.nirvanastudio.org/wiki/ShiningRay]ShiningRay[/url] @ [url=http://www.nirvanastudio.org/]Nirvana Studio[/url]原始出处:[url=http://www.nirvanastudio.org/javascript/improve-javascript-

2007-02-28 17:31:00 499

原创 JavaScript的对象

JavaScript语言是基于对象的(Object-Based),而不是面向对象的(object-oriented)。    之所以说它是一门基于对象的语言,主要是因为它没有提供象抽象、继承、重载等有关面向对象语言的许多功能。而是把其它语言所创建的复杂对象统一起来,从而形成一个非常强大的对象系统。         虽然JavaScript语言是一门基于对象的,但它还是具有一些面向对象的基本特征

2007-02-06 19:25:00 1094

原创 深入认识JavaScript中的函数

概述函数是进行模块化程序设计的基础,编写复杂的Ajax应用程序,必须对函数有更深入的了解。JavaScript中的函数不同于其他的语言,每个函数都是作为一个对象被维护和运行的。通过函数对象的性质,可以很方便的将一个函数赋值给一个变量或者将函数作为参数传递。在继续讲述之前,先看一下函数的使用语法:function func1(…){…}var func2=function(…){…};var fun

2007-02-06 16:45:00 518

转载 javascript技巧大全

Event 事件 事件源对象event.srcElement.tagNameevent.srcElement.type捕获释放event.srcElement.setCapture();event.srcElement.releaseCapture();事件按键event.keyCodeevent.shiftKeyevent.altKeyevent.ctrlKey事件返回值event.retu

2007-02-06 16:04:00 844

转载 javascript中String 对象属性和方法

属性 1.constructor 指定创建一个对象的函数。 constructor 属性是每个具有原型的对象的原型成员。这包括除了 arguments、Enumerator、Error、Global、Math

2007-02-06 15:11:00 617

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除